GREATHAM BOY LOOKS GOOD FOR 3YO SPRINT
The Straits Times
|April 03, 2024
Four meetings left, trainer Gray can bank on Bransom for a win
 Greatham Boy is looking good and, after that fluent win at his last start, his connections could be thinking that their boy could lift the big one on April 6.
Trainer Tim Fitzsimmons and the Greatham Boy Stable will go into the Group 3 Singapore ThreeYear-Old Sprint (1,200m) carrying high hopes. It will not come as any surprise to see their galloper romp home.
For one thing, Greatham Boy is better than good.
In a short career, he has amassed close to $150,000 in career earnings and, to think, he has only raced six times for three wins, a second and a third.
As if to remind those who do not already know, it was on April 2 that Fitzsimmons sent Greatham Boy for an early morning spin on the training track.
It was probably to tie up loose ends and the son of Stratosphere turned in a stirring gallop, running the 600m in 39.3sec.
As it stands, Greatham Boy will be in his comfort zone when the runners are called in for the $110,000 race.
He will feel the turf under his hooves which is something he likes. And he will gobble up the 1,200m trip like a kid slurping an ice cream.
